1. What is a Bifold Door?

Bifold doors include two or more panels that move and fold open along a track. They are created to maximize space and are often utilized in areas such as closets, patios, and space separators. When totally opened, they produce a big opening, enabling much better airflow and natural light.

4. Solutions for Repair

Here are some suggested actions to repair a broken bifold door:

Steps to Fix Bifold Door Issues

  1. Assessment:
    Begin by carefully examining the door. Identify the particular problem: Is it off track, misaligned, or harmed?

Realignment:
For doors that are off track:

  • Remove the door from the track.
  • Check and clean up the track for debris.
  • Realign and re-install the door, ensuring it fits properly within the track.

Rolling Mechanism Maintenance:
If rollers are used:

  • Replace harmed rollers; most can be found at local hardware stores.
  • Lube all moving parts with appropriate door lubricant (avoid oil-based products).

Repairing or Replacing Panels:
For harmed panels:

  • Minor scratches and damages can typically be sanded and touched up with paint or varnish.
  • Think about changing panels if the damage is extreme.

5. Preventative Maintenance Tips

A little preventative care can go a long way in lengthening the life of bifold doors. Here are some key maintenance tips:

Maintenance TaskFrequency
Clean tracks and rollersEvery 3 to 6 months
Inspect for wear and damageAnnually
Oil moving partsEvery 6 months
Inspect positioningBiannually
Make sure door isn't overwhelmedAs required

By sticking to these maintenance tasks, homeowners can significantly reduce the possibility of coming across bifold door problems.
